        /// <summary>
        /// We attempt to execute an expression (list of functions) on an empty stack.
        /// When no exception is raised we know that the subexpression can be replaced with anything
        /// that generates the values.
        /// </summary>
        static CatExpr PartialEval(Executor exec, CatExpr fxns)
        {
            // Recursively partially evaluate all quotations
            for (int i = 0; i < fxns.Count; ++i)
            {
                Function f = fxns[i];
                if (f is PushFunction)
                {
                    PushFunction q   = f as PushFunction;
                    CatExpr      tmp = PartialEval(new Executor(), q.GetSubFxns());
                    fxns[i] = new PushFunction(tmp);
                }
            }

            CatExpr ret = new CatExpr();

            object[] values = null;

            int j = 0;

            while (j < fxns.Count)
            {
                try {
                    Function f = fxns[j];

                    if (f is DefinedFunction)
                    {
                        f.Eval(exec);
                    }
                    else
                    {
                        if (f.GetFxnType() == null)
                        {
                            throw new Exception("no type availables");
                        }

                        if (f.GetFxnType().HasSideEffects())
                        {
                            throw new Exception("can't perform partial execution when an expression has side-effects");
                        }

                        f.Eval(exec);
                    }

                    // at each step, we have to get the values stored so far
                    // since they could keep changing and any exception
                    // will obliterate the old values.
                    values = exec.GetStackAsArray();
                } catch {
                    if (values != null)
                    {
                        // Copy all of the values from the previous good execution
                        for (int k = values.Length - 1; k >= 0; --k)
                        {
                            ret.Add(ValueToFunction(values[k]));
                        }
                    }
                    ret.Add(fxns[j]);
                    exec.Clear();
                    values = null;
                }
                j++;
            }

            if (values != null)
            {
                for (int l = values.Length - 1; l >= 0; --l)
                {
                    ret.Add(ValueToFunction(values[l]));
                }
            }

            return(ret);
        }
